This research aims to analyze the implementation of spending using the SAKTI application in government work units based on the Regulation of the Minister of Finance of the Republic of Indonesia Number 210/PMK.05/2022 concerning Payment Procedures in the Context of Implementing the State Revenue and Expenditure Budget. This research is normative juridical, using statute and conceptual approaches, written descriptively analytically. The study analyzes the payment procedures for goods purchases by government work units in the treasurer module of the SAKTI application. The research results generally show that government work units have experienced the benefits of SAKTI in terms of administration and payment of government work units according to the mechanisms/procedures established by applicable regulations. Various interpretations of payment techniques using the SAKTI application have resulted in additional procedures carried out by government work units that are not regulated and even conflict with the Regulation of the Minister of Finance of the Republic of Indonesia Number 210/PMK.05/2022.  Additional procedures that conflict with regulations need to be evaluated and refined in the SAKTI application so that it complies with generally applicable legal provisions and principles.

Jockey services in higher education used by students are a form of ethical violation and are subject to sanctions. The legal umbrella of the prohibition of jockey services is regulated in Article 15 paragraph (2) of the Law on the National Education System, Article 18 to Article 20 of the Regulation of the Minister of Education, Culture Research and Technology on Quality Assurance of Higher Education, Article 72 of the Law on Copyright and several regulations made by universities. However, jockeying services are often equated with the term plagiarism, which, of course, has a different meaning, so law enforcement against the handling of jockeying services is still unclear. This research uses normative research. The nature of the research is descriptive qualitative. Data collection methods using literature study. Legal materials consist of primary legal materials, secondary legal materials, and tertiary legal materials. The analysis used is a qualitative method. The need for law enforcement in final assignment jockey services is essential because every related legal product still terms jockey services, including plagiarism, which actually has a difference. In addition, universities certainly have strict regulations and oppose the act of cheating in the university environment. Regulations regarding jockey services in universities are the first milestone in regulating the use of jockey services.

Sufferers of BDSM and homosexual mental disorders are at great risk of being involved in criminal acts, but there is no law that specifically regulates criminal acts committed from BDSM and homosexual activities. The aim of this research is to determine the extent of legal urgency required for perpetrators of criminal acts who have sexual disorders which are included in mental disorders because Article 44 of the Criminal Code only regulates reasons for forgiveness for ODGJ. This research uses qualitative research methods and a descriptive approach and uses normative data collection techniques. The results of the research obtained are that there are no monetary crime laws regulating sexual disorders, especially BDSM, however, the crime of sodomy can be charged under the obscenity article of the Criminal Code and the Child Protection Law. Perpetrators of criminal acts who have sexual disorders are also subject to law because they do not fulfill the elements stated in Article 44 of the Criminal Code.

Following the issuance of Constitutional Court Decision Number 46/PUU-VIII/2010 concerning amendments and additions to Article 43 of Law Number 1 of 1974 concerning Marriage, significant changes have been made to family law in Indonesia. These changes pertain specifically to the status of children born out of wedlock who may now be legitimized. Constitutional Court Decision Number 46/PUU-VIII/2010 declares and confirms that children born out of wedlock can now have civil relationships with their biological fathers akin to legitimate children, not only with their mothers and maternal families. Previously, children born out of wedlock only had civil relationships with their mothers and maternal families. To establish a civil relationship with a child born out of wedlock, the biological father must acknowledge paternity. In practice, the biological father can acknowledge paternity by petitioning the District Court, and the custody rights over the child born out of wedlock lie with the biological father. This can be substantiated through scientific and technological evidence or other legal evidence. The research conducted is of a normative legal nature, and the data analysis employs a qualitative descriptive method

This study delves into the integration of customary law values with modern mediation in resolving land disputes in Indonesia, often marked by tensions between individual and communal interests as well as between customary law and national law. Employing a normative legal research methodology, this investigation explores relevant regulations, including the Basic Agrarian Law (UUPA) and the Law on Arbitration and Alternative Dispute Resolution, to understand how to harmonize the principles of customary law and mediation without undermining the supremacy of law at the national level. The research identifies two core issues: how distributive and procedural justice can be realized through this integration. Findings indicate that formal recognition of customary mediation outcomes and a comprehensive regulatory framework are crucial for establishing a fair and effective dispute resolution mechanism. This study advocates for the development of regulations that celebrate legal diversity, positioning land dispute resolution as a process that interweaves human values with local wisdom while simultaneously reinforcing the legitimacy of customary law within the national legal framework.
